Using the Remote Control

Press and hold the button down until the door or gate
starts to move. The remote control will operate from up
to 3 car lengths away on typical installations. Installations
and conditions vary, contact an installing dealer for more
information.
3-BUTTON REMOTE CONTROLS
Additional buttons on the remote control can be
programmed to operate up to 3 devices such as additional
garage door openers, light controls, gate operators or
access control systems.
TO CONTROL THE OPENER LIGHTS
Additional buttons on the remote control can be
programmed to operate the garage door opener lights
without opening the door.
1. With the door closed, press and hold the remote button
that you want to control the light.
2. Press and hold the Light button on the

THE REMOTE CONTROL BATTERY
To prevent possible SERIOUS INJURY or DEATH:
• NEVER allow small children near batteries.
• If battery is swallowed, immediately notify doctor.
To reduce risk of fi re, explosion or chemical burn:
• Replace ONLY with 3V2016 or 3V2450 coin
batteries.
• DO NOT recharge, disassemble, heat above 100° C
(212° F) or incinerate.
The LED(s) on your remote control will stop fl ashing when
the battery is low and needs to be replaced. To replace
battery, open the case as shown. Insert battery positive
side up (+). Replace the battery with only 3V2016 coin cell
batteries. Dispose of old battery properly.
